Unmasking the Occupational Hazards: How Railroad Work Increases Throat Cancer Risk

The railroad environment, traditionally and even in some elements today, provides a mixed drink of carcinogenic direct exposures that can considerably increase the danger of establishing different cancers, including those affecting the throat. A number of essential offenders have been recognized:

  • Asbestos Exposure: For much of the 20th century, asbestos was a common product in the railroad industry. It was treasured for its heat resistance and insulating homes and was commonly utilized in locomotive boilers, brake shoes, insulation for pipes and buildings, and even in some forms of clothes. When asbestos materials are disrupted, tiny fibers end up being airborne and can be inhaled. While asbestos is most strongly linked to lung cancer and mesothelioma, studies have likewise suggested a connection to pharyngeal and laryngeal cancers. Employees associated with maintenance, repair, demolition, and even regular train operation were frequently exposed to significant levels of asbestos.
  • Diesel Exhaust Fumes: Diesel-powered locomotives and devices have long been the workhorses of the railroad industry. The exhaust from diesel motor is an intricate mixture including various hazardous compounds, including particulate matter, nitrogen oxides, and polycyclic aromatic hydrocarbons (PAHs). Long-lasting exposure to diesel exhaust fumes has been categorized as carcinogenic by the International Agency for Research on Cancer (IARC). Railroad employees in railyards, engine shops, and even those dealing with trains were regularly exposed to these fumes, increasing their threat of respiratory cancers, consisting of throat cancer.
  • Creosote Exposure: Creosote, a coal-tar derivative, has been and continues to be used to deal with railroad ties to avoid wood rot and insect problem. Creosote consists of a complicated mixture of chemicals, consisting of PAHs, a lot of which are known carcinogens. Employees involved in the handling, installation, and maintenance of railroad ties, along with those operating in locations where creosote-treated ties are prevalent, are at threat of direct exposure through skin contact, inhalation of vapors, and even consumption. Studies have connected creosote exposure to numerous cancers, including skin, lung, and possibly throat cancer.
  • Silica Dust: Silica, a common mineral found in sand and rock, is an element of ballast, the gravel utilized to support railroad tracks. Activities like track upkeep, ballast handling, and even basic dust created in railyards can release respirable crystalline silica. Chronic inhalation of silica dust is known to trigger silicosis, a serious lung disease, and is likewise classified as a carcinogen. While the link to throat cancer is less direct than with asbestos or diesel exhaust, research recommends that silica direct exposure can contribute to general respiratory cancer danger and possibly impact the throat location.
  • Welding Fumes and Metal Exposure: Railroad maintenance and repair work frequently involve welding. Welding fumes consist of metal particles and gases, depending on the products being welded and the welding procedure used. Exposure to certain metal fumes, such as hexavalent chromium and nickel substances, is understood to be carcinogenic. Welders and those operating in proximity to welding operations in railroad settings could be exposed to these harmful fumes, potentially increasing their cancer danger.

Understanding Throat Cancer: Types and Manifestations

" Throat cancer" is a broad term incorporating cancers that develop in the pharynx (the throat itself) and the larynx (voice box). These are carefully associated but unique locations, and cancers in these areas are additional classified by area:

Pharyngeal Cancer: This type develops in the throat, which is divided into three parts:

  • Nasopharynx: The upper part of the throat, behind the nose.
  • Oropharynx: The middle part of the throat, consisting of the tonsils and base of the tongue.
  • Hypopharynx: The lower part of the throat, near the esophagus and trachea.
  • Laryngeal Cancer: This cancer comes from the larynx, which lies in the neck and includes the vocal cables.

Signs of throat cancer can vary depending upon the place and phase however may consist of:

  • Persistent sore throat
  • Hoarseness or changes in voice
  • Trouble swallowing (dysphagia)
  • Ear pain
  • Lump in the neck
  • Inexplicable weight-loss
  • Consistent cough
  • Spending blood

It's important to keep in mind that these signs can likewise be triggered by other, less severe conditions. However, if experiencing any of these signs, especially if you have a history of railroad work or other threat factors, it's necessary to consult a physician for prompt medical diagnosis and treatment.

The Federal Employers Liability Act (FELA): A Key Legal Tool

Unlike a lot of markets covered by state employees' compensation systems, railroad employees are protected under the Federal Employers Liability Act (FELA). FELA, enacted in 1908, provides railroad workers with the right to sue their employers for injuries sustained on the task. This is a vital distinction as FELA is often more useful to workers than standard workers' compensation.

Under FELA, a railroad employee can sue their company if they can prove neglect on the part of the railroad that added to their injury or disease, consisting of throat cancer. Carelessness can include various aspects, such as:

  • Failure to offer a safe workplace: This might include inadequate ventilation, absence of protective equipment, or failure to alert workers about understood hazards like asbestos, diesel exhaust, or creosote.
  • Infraction of safety regulations: Railroads need to stick to various federal safety guidelines. Infractions that contribute to worker disease can be premises for a FELA claim.
  • Failure to adequately train and supervise staff members: Insufficient training on safe handling of dangerous materials or lack of proper supervision can likewise constitute carelessness.

Showing the Link: Establishing Causation in Throat Cancer Cases

A considerable challenge in railroad throat cancer settlement cases is developing a direct causal link between the worker's cancer and their railroad work. Cancer is a complicated illness, and multiple elements can add to its advancement. Nevertheless, experienced attorneys focusing on FELA and railroad cancer cases use different types of proof to build a strong case:

  • Medical Records: Detailed medical records, including diagnosis, treatment history, and pathology reports, are crucial to document the type and extent of the throat cancer.
  • Work History: A comprehensive work history describing the worker's task roles, areas, and period of employment within the railroad industry is essential to recognize prospective direct exposure durations and sources.
  • Direct exposure History: This includes event proof of particular exposures to recognized carcinogens like asbestos, diesel exhaust, creosote, silica, and welding fumes throughout the worker's time in the railroad market. This might include company records, witness testimonies, or expert evaluations of historic workplace conditions.
  • Expert Testimony: Medical experts, such as oncologists and occupational medicine specialists, can offer essential testament connecting the worker's particular kind of throat cancer to the recognized occupational risks present in the railroad environment. Industrial hygiene professionals can also testify about the levels of exposure employees most likely dealt with.
  • Company Records and Policies: Documents connected to company safety policies, danger cautions, and material usage (particularly relating to asbestos and creosote) can reveal whether the railroad understood the threats and took appropriate steps to secure its workers.

Who is at Risk? Railroad Occupations and Potential Exposure

While any railroad employee could possibly be at risk depending on their specific roles and work areas, certain task categories have actually historically dealt with higher levels of direct exposure to carcinogenic substances:

  • Locomotive Mechanics and Shop Workers: These workers often dealt with asbestos-containing components in engines and were exposed to diesel exhaust and welding fumes.
  • Track Maintenance Workers and Laborers: Track employees were exposed to creosote-treated ties, silica dust from ballast, and potentially diesel exhaust from upkeep devices.
  • Boilermakers and Pipefitters: Workers associated with keeping and repairing locomotive boilers and pipelines were heavily exposed to asbestos insulation.
  • Engineers and Conductors: While less directly associated with maintenance and repair, train operating teams were still exposed to diesel exhaust fumes and possibly asbestos fibers within locomotive taxis.
  • Brakemen and Switchmen: Similar to engineers and conductors, these employees experienced diesel exhaust exposure and prospective asbestos exposure through brake shoe dust and general ecological contamination in railyards.
